> At the risk of showing that I don't follow the mail list closely,
> I've looked at the last two weeks and don't see any dialogue
> regarding the national forest closures. Angeles, San Bernardino,
> and Cleveland National Forests have been closed until the end of
> November. They are considering closing the Los Padres as well.
> Only major highway traffic is allowed through NF lands -- no
> stopping along the road. County and BLM lands are not affected.
> The fine for being found inside the forest boundaries is $5,000
> per individual, $10,000 per organization. Rumor has it that the
> rangers aren't issuing warnings. This has created a furor amongst
> outdoor enthusiasts, you can be sure. (This humble author is
> simply reporting facts as known -- I'll leave the postulating to
> y'all.)
>
> There are a few southbound PCTers on their way; their boxes show
> their arrival some time this week. Doesn't look like they're
> going to be able to finish.
